Elijah’s story is compelling. Before his 20th birthday, he founded a Christian film company, has written and directed films. Steadfast Pictures is a homegrown family endeavor that offers a Christian alternative to Hollywood’s lies and propaganda. Praise the Lord!

The purpose of Writer’s Talk is to encourage writers that the Lord is prodding (but are hesitant) to step out and write. We discussed the writing process and my testimony books. Praise the Lord!
